Your Shopify store is your online storefront, and its look plays a crucial role in attracting and retaining customers. A well-designed storefront not only looks appealing but also enhances user experience, leading to higher sales and brand recognition.
To develop a winning online presence, consider these essential design elements:
* **Visually Appealing Layout:** A clear and structured layout helps customers easily discover your products.
Use high-quality images, attractive graphics, and whitespace to improve readability and visual appeal.
* **Mobile Responsiveness:** With the rise of mobile shopping, it's essential that your Shopify store is fully optimized to different screen sizes.
Ensure a seamless browsing experience on smartphones and tablets for maximum customer engagement.
* **Compelling Product Pages:** Your product pages should provide detailed information about your offerings, including high-quality images, clear descriptions, and customer reviews.
Use powerful language to highlight the benefits of your products.
* **Streamlined Checkout Process:** A fast and secure checkout process is crucial for converting browsing customers.
Minimize the number of steps required, offer multiple payment options, and ensure a shopify store design safe and trustworthy transaction environment.
By focusing on these design essentials, you can create a Shopify store that not only looks great but also effectively retains customers, drives sales, and establishes a strong online presence for your brand.

Shopify Store Design on a Budget
Launching an online store with Shopify is exciting but can feel overwhelming when considering design costs. Don't stress! You can craft a stunning and functional storefront without breaking the bank.
Here are some savvy strategies to make your Shopify store appear its best on a budget:
* **Embrace Free Themes:** Shopify offers a wide array of free themes that are both stylish and practical. Explore the theme library and find one that reflects your brand's aesthetic.
* **Customize with Apps:** Elevate your store's functionality and appearance with free or affordable apps. Many apps provide features like SEO optimization, social media integration, and customizable elements.
* **Leverage Stock Photos & Graphics:** High-quality visuals are essential for drawing customer attention. Utilize free stock photo websites and design resources to find compelling images that align with your brand.
* **Create Engaging Content:** Well-written product descriptions, informative blog posts, and captivating visuals can improve your store's appeal and user experience, even without expensive design elements.
